When it comes to exhibiting self-restraint in the face of adversity or stress, having a controlled temper can be a valuable asset. But what other words might we use to describe this admirable trait? Synonyms for "controlled temper" could include "calm demeanor," "composed attitude," "level-headedness," "serenity," "poise," "equanimity," "cool-headedness," "self-possession," "self-restraint," "restraint," "balance," "moderation," "temperate," "collectedness," "unflappable," and "steadiness." Each of these words conveys a sense of balance, moderation, and calmness in the face of difficulty, highlighting the importance of keeping one's composure even in the most stressful situations.
